How to Know If You Should Get Wildlife Control Services?

Spotting the clues of wildlife encroachment is vital to determining the necessity for professional extraction services. Homeowners should remain vigilant for unusual sounds, such as scraping or scampering, notably at night. Noticeable markers, like droppings, nesting areas, or eaten wires, indicate that animals have taken residence. Unexplained destruction to property, including holes in walls or roofs, can also reveal an invasion.

Additionally, if a homeowner detects rising pest infestation, such as bugs or rats, it may indicate that bigger animals is in the area. Foul smells coming from concealed areas often point to deceased wildlife or debris, which creates a health risk.

In the event that any of these signs are detected, it is wise to contact wildlife removal professionals. They have the expertise to responsibly and efficiently address the problem, assuring both property protection and peace of mind for residents.

Understanding the Health Dangers of Animal Infestations

Although many tend to overlook the occurrence of wildlife in their homes, the medical threats associated with infestations can be significant. Wildlife including rodents, raccoons, and bats can carry diseases that represent serious dangers to human health. For instance, rodents can carry hantavirus and leptospirosis, while raccoons may carry rabies and raccoon roundworm. These diseases can spread through direct contact, droppings, or contaminated surfaces.

Additionally, wildlife intrusions can exacerbate allergies and asthma, particularly due to the allergens found in animal urine and dander. In addition, the potential for structural damage caused by gnawing or nesting behaviors can introduce further health hazards, such as mold growth from damp environments.

Disregarding these hazards not only puts at risk personal health but also weakens the safety of household members and animals. Quick pest removal solutions are necessary to address these health threats effectively.

Techniques to Ensure Your Home Stays Wildlife-Free

To preserve a wildlife-free home, residents must implement active measures to discourage potential intruders. Initially, securing entry points is essential; this involves sealing gaps in foundations, walls, and roofs. Placing screens over chimneys and vents additionally decreases access. Furthermore, keeping outdoor areas tidy blocks wildlife from obtaining sustenance and cover. Regularly trimming trees and shrubs deters animals from settling near to the house.

Correct refuse handling is also important. Using enclosed garbage cans and composting responsibly minimizes attractants, while eliminating pet food and birdseed from outside helps get rid of easy food sources. Homeowners should also consider installing motion-sensor sprinklers or lights, which can drive away wildlife.

Finally, regular inspections of the premises can help detect potential problem areas before they worsen. By implementing these preventative measures, homeowners can significantly decrease the chances of wildlife encounters, guaranteeing a secure and tranquil living environment.
